Hi everyone,

 

I'm encountering an issue when creating a Data Exchange from Autodesk Inventor. It seems that fitting geometry (such as pipe fittings) is not included in the generated exchange.

To clarify:

  • The fittings are visible in the Inventor assembly.
  • They exist in the project structure.
  • However, when viewing the Data Exchange in Autodesk Construction Cloud (ACC), the fittings are missing.

I've attached three images:

  1. Inventor view – showing the complete model.
  2. Project structure – confirming that the fittings are included.
  3. Data Exchange in ACC – where the fittings are missing.

Has anyone experienced this issue before? Could it be a setting, a known limitation, or something else? Any guidance on how to ensure the fittings are properly included would be greatly appreciated!
